How much do you want to spend a night? Do you want to be across from the beach?

Restaurants:

La Yuca Caliente Italian

Navias German

Tres Caravelle

Mojitos Cuban

Luis' on the beach at Coson, grilled seafood and chicken

Need more let me know?

Villa Mariposas is convenient and has beautiful grounds and several swimming pools + a bar. You can rent ATV's directly from them and walk to the fisherman's village.

German Foods Import

WHo'd want food imported from Germany in the Dominican Republic?

Germans. :laugh:
(Also Austrians, Swiss and other Europeans who cherish German food, of course).

There are several Germans (in SD and Sos?a) who import German food to sell it to the German (speaking) community.
In fact, there is an Italian and a Dominican supermarket in Las Terrenas selling German products and "Good Old Germany" meat products (from Sos?a) can be bought in various places.

ok Where you MUST go is Luis on the beach at Coson.. best to go on a weekend to see the locals or on weekday to avoid them.

watch the sea carefully, this is a surfing beach..

there is a great massage therapist there on weekends .. (no, NOT the happy ending kind)

you spend the day there.

have your concho guy take you out and come and get you. It is a fantastic ride out on a concho... through the chocolate tree groves.
